Output 26f2a973029112929783e99de5ae089b88d34ceaee6f818ae4c2adcfec2d7cb6:8

value
5645046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ea6238d76c059b78496af3ea0fcd1ebf1bffc379623ad4572a371f46c7061555
address
bc1paf3r34mvqkdhsjt2704qlng7hudllsmevgadg4e2xu05d3cxz42sqvtvvh
transaction
26f2a973029112929783e99de5ae089b88d34ceaee6f818ae4c2adcfec2d7cb6
confirmations
63093
spent
true